Since its establishment in 1917, Mitsui Engineering & Shipbuilding (MES) has provided trusted products and plants for the society. MES has 3 main business segment, which are Ship & Ocean, Machinery & Systems, and Engineering. Machinery & Systems segment mainly provides marine diesel engines and cranes. Engineering segment provides EPC (Engineering, Procurement, and Construction) service to construct petrochemical and environmental plant. MES has put efforts on the mid-term business plan 2011 starting from FY2011 to FY2013. Although FY2013 has not yet ended, MES set up a new mid-term business plan (new plan) starting from FY2014 to FY2016 to respond to the substantial change in the business environment and started the new plan from the FY2013.more

The Imabari Shipbuilding Group specializes in constructing and repairing a wide range of ships. More than 90 ships are constructed annually based in 3 business offices and 9 shipyards concentrated in the Seto Inland Sea region. In addition, our sales and marketing departments are headquartered in the Tokyo Branch Office. The flexibility and mobility of our network ensures an efficient production strategy ranging from market research to construction, and provides appropriate solutions.more
